WELCOME
The Office of the Treasurer is the steward of the University’s financial
resources, practicing sound financial management in support of academic,
scientific and faculty excellence. Reporting directly to the Executive Vice
President and Chief Operating Officer, the Treasurer’s office ensures the
sustainability of the University’s mission and goals by:

Managing cash, investments, and debt effectively

Demonstrating sound financial leadership

Facilitating risk management strategies

Strengthening relationships with UVA foundations
